About the role

The Laboratory Specialist II is responsible for the processing and assisting with the management of biological samples collected during clinical trials. The role ensures tasks performed are conducted within compliance of study protocol, Good Clinical Practices (GCP) and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s).

Responsibilities

  • Ensure the confidentiality of clinical trial participants and sponsors is respected, while maintaining a high level of quality within the department.
  • Report procedural deviations, issues and/or problem resolutions to appropriate supervisory team members.
  • Understand protocol driven timed study events, which may include but are not limited to, centrifugation, study and clinical diagnostic sample handling/processing, storing samples and acceptable windows (protocol and/or SOP driven) for the timed events.
